They went into the game knowing exactly that they have to win to make sure that they get a victory, Kaizer Chiefs knew that they have to come out and throw everything at their visitors in search for an equalizer after having gone into the break trailing by 2-1, they applied pressure to Swallows FC as they were looking for a second goal to level matters, they had up to 12 corner kicks but none of them was converted into a goal, they were all wasted with just one nearly causing trouble for The Dube Birds, that was a header from Siyabonga Ngezana, but the ball struck the upright much to the disappoinment of the tall defender.

The Naturena based outfit were in a mean mood and were showing that they really needed that goal as they launched attack after attack, but nothing was coming out of those chances, they did not really trouble their former goalkeeper Daniel Akpeyi who was in goal for Swallows, there were no clear cut scoring opportunities created by Chiefs, the defense stood their ground and managed to keep Amakhosi’s attackers away from the scoring area to make sure that they keep the all important points.

Substitute Wandile Duba came close to finding an equalizer on the 87th minute after receiving a lovely pass from Samkelo Zwane, his shot was way off-target as he failed to beat the on-rushing Akpeyi, it was clear that there was no coming back for Chiefs who did not create that much chances, but they kept knocking and they got more corner kicks, from one of them, Ahley Du Preez drew a great save from Akpeyi who had to stretch fully to push the ball away for the 15th corner.

Keegan Allan required urgebt medical attention after he collapsed following a challenge with Dylan Solomon, the referee Mr Enock Muvhali was seen rushing to the bench to get the oxygen cylinder as he assisted the medical staff who were already on the pitch, the player was given first aid and everyone was clapping when he was up on his feet walking off the pitch on his own without being carried on a stretcher.

With just a minute to play, Chiefs won corner number 16 and still there was no goal for Amakhosi, despite having added a couple of seconds, the referee blew the final whistle shortly after the corner kick and that meant a defeat for the Nedbank Cup semi-finalists, the win for Swallows meant that they are safe from relegation and Chiefs should forget about playing in Champions League.
